SEVENTEEN just added another notch to their list of top 10 United States achievements! Their latest mini-album “SPILL THE FEELS” launched straight to No. 5, making the boy group the second act with the most top 10 Billboard 200 entries by a South Korean act, just one spot shy of BTS.
This recent accomplishment breaks their tie with other top-tier groups like Stray Kids and ATEEZ, solidifying SEVENTEEN’S place in America. With 65,500 equivalent units moved (63,700 in pure album sales) “SPILL THE FEELS” also dominated Billboard’s Top Album Sales, underscoring the power of SEVENTEEN’S fan base in the country.
While BTS holds the throne, the “God of Music” singers have slowly built a solid chart legacy, surpassing many of their K-pop peers. For now, the group and their fans (also known as Carats) are savoring their well-earned spot as the K-pop act with the second-most Billboard 200 top 10s, proving they’re a group with both staying power and star power.
